This document describes a dice game where the player rolls two dice and adds the totals. Depending on the total, the player either loses money, gains money, or neither loses nor gains. The game is attractive because rolling a 7 has the highest payout. While predictions estimated making $0.56 per game on average, experimental results showed losing $0.80 per game on average. This was likely due to an unusually high number of 7s rolled in the small sample size. Over more games, the averages and standard deviation would be closer to the predictions as the law of large numbers takes effect.
